DevOps Engineer
Arm Limited
Charing Cross, United Kingdom
2 days ago
Role details
Contract type
Temporary contract Employment type
Full-time (> 32 hours) Working hours
Regular working hours Languages
English Experience level
Senior Compensation
£ 56KJob location
Charing Cross, United Kingdom
Tech stack
Java
Microsoft Windows
Amazon Web Services (AWS)
Cloud Computing
Configuration Management
Databases
Continuous Integration
Linux
DevOps
Github
Log Analysis
Cloud Services
Ansible
Prometheus
Datadog
Delivery Pipeline
Technical Debt
Gitlab
Cloudformation
SC Clearance
Containerization
Kubernetes
Cloudwatch
Puppet
Terraform
New Relic (SaaS)
Docker
ELK
Jenkins
Job description
- Lead the design, deployment, and management of scalable and reliable AWS Cloud infrastructures, driving automation and optimizing DevOps processes.
- Develop and implement advanced CI/CD strategies to support complex, large-scale cloud solutions on AWS.
- Engage directly with clients to provide technical expertise, offer solutions to complex cloud challenges, and act as a trusted advisor in their cloud journey.
- Lead technical discussions with developers and stakeholders, influencing architectural decisions and setting DevOps standards across teams.
- Drive continuous improvement initiatives by automating repetitive tasks, remediating technical debt, and identifying opportunities for optimization.
- Mentor and coach junior engineers, fostering a culture of knowledge sharing and continuous learning.
- Stay up to date with the latest cloud technologies, DevOps tools, and industry trends, recommending new approaches to enhance our services.
Technologies:
- AWS
- Ansible
- Architect
- CI/CD
- Cloud
- CloudWatch
- Datadog
- DevOps
- Docker
- ELK
- GitHub
- GitLab
- Support
- Java
- Jenkins
- Kubernetes
- Linux
- Prometheus
- Puppet
- Security
- Terraform
- Windows
- ARM, We are seeking a Principal AWS DevOps Engineer for a 5-month contract based in London, offering hybrid working with three days in the office. You will be a critical team member responsible for designing, implementing, and optimizing end-to-end DevOps processes. This role provides a unique opportunity to blend strategic thinking with hands-on execution, enhancing our cloud environments. We value a culture of continuous integration, delivery, and improvement, and we are committed to mentoring our team members. Please note that current and active SC Clearance is required to be considered for this position.
Requirements
- 10+ years of experience in provisioning, configuring, and maintaining AWS Cloud environments, focusing on large-scale, mission-critical infrastructures.
- In-depth expertise in a wide range of AWS service offerings, including Compute, Management & Governance, Storage, Security, Identity & Compliance, Networking & Content Delivery, FinOps, Containers, and Database products.
- Extensive hands-on experience in the design, development, and management of Java applications.
- Extensive hands-on experience with Infrastructure as Code (IaC) tools such as AWS CloudFormation, Terraform, or CDK, with a proven track record of automating cloud infrastructure deployments.
- Advanced knowledge of containerization technologies and orchestration platforms like Docker and Amazon EKS (Kubernetes) or ECS.
- Expertise in defining, implementing, and optimizing CI/CD pipelines using tools such as AWS CodePipeline, Jenkins, GitLab, GitHub Actions, and applying best practices for pipeline efficiency and security.
- Strong background in networking, Linux or Windows administration, with the ability to architect secure, performant, and highly available cloud solutions.
- Proficiency with monitoring and log analytics tools such as AWS CloudWatch, ELK Stack, Prometheus, Datadog, or New Relic to maintain observability and ensure operational excellence.
- Demonstrated leadership skills in managing complex, high-pressure situations and guiding teams through incident resolution.
- Exceptional communication and presentation skills, with proven experience engaging with senior stakeholders.
- Relevant AWS certifications (nice to have).
- Experience with configuration management tools (Chef, Puppet, Ansible) and implementing best practices for configuration management and automation (nice to have).
- Deep understanding of Cloud Landing Zone concepts and best practices for enterprise-scale cloud adoption (nice to have).